Research on Dynamic Properties of Aluminum Foam Sandwich Structure Impacted by Projectiles with Different Shapes

Abstract: The experiments of impacting the aluminum foam sandwich panels by spherical, pointed and flat nose projectiles launched from gas gun were carried to study the dynamic properties of aluminum foam sandwich structure. Based on LS-DYNA software, the impacts of different projectiles on aluminum foam sandwich panels are simulated, and the influences of different projectile shapes and speed on the energy absorption characteristics of sandwich panels are analyzed. The experimental results are well in agreement withe the simulated results. The results show that the deformation mode of pointed projectile is basically the same as that of spherical projectile, the flat nose projectile damages the sandwich panels more seriously during penetrating, the front and rear panels exhibit a tear failure mode, and the compacted aluminum foam is bonded to the rear panel after penetration. The head of pointed projectile is sharp, the contact area between the warhead and the target is small, and the penetration force is large. The contact area between the warhead of flat noise projectile and the target is large, and the penetration force is small, but the target damage area is large and the impact is more effective. The impact effect of spherical projectile is between those of pointed and flat nose projectiles: the improvement in the thicknesses and material properties of front and sandwich panels can better improve the penetration resistance of aluminum foam sandwich panel at low impact speed; the proportion of energy absorption of rear panel increases gradually, the improvement in the thickness and material properties of rear panel can improve the penetration resistance of sandwich panel at high impact speed.
